Process Costing
A method of costing used to ascertain the cost of a product at each process or stage of manufacture.
Weighted-Average Method
An inventory costing method that assigns a weighted average cost to each unit of inventory on hand.
Equivalent Unit
An accounting measure used to compute the number of units produced during a reporting period, converting partially completed units into an equivalent number of fully completed units.
Equivalent Units
A concept used in process costing that converts work-in-process inventory to a number of fully finished units.
